二、安裝操作系統
三、配置服務器環境
四、上傳網站文件
五、綁定域名
六、啟動網站服務
一、購買百度云服務器
首先,我們需要進入百度云官網,注冊一個賬號并且登錄。然后,點擊“產品與服務”—“云計算”中的“云服務器”選項,進入到云服務器購買頁面。
在購買頁面中,我們可以根據自己的需求選擇適合自己的云服務器套餐。百度云的云服務器有多種機型和配置,不同的機型和配置對應不同的價格和性能。如果是初次使用,建議選擇低配的機型進行實驗和搭建。
在購買頁面中,我們可以選擇操作系統、數據中心、存儲、網絡等配置,根據自己的需求進行選擇。選擇完畢之后,我們需要輸入實例名稱、設置管理員密碼等相關參數,并且付款購買。
購買成功之后,我們就可以在控制臺中看到自己購買的云服務器實例了。
二、安裝操作系統
在購買云服務器的時候,我們可以選擇不同的操作系統進行安裝。在這里,我們選擇 CentOS 7.x 64位操作系統。
安裝步驟如下:
1. 登錄百度云控制臺,找到云服務器實例,點擊其右側的“管理”按鈕,進入實例詳情頁。
2. 在實例詳情頁中,找到“遠程登錄”一欄,點擊“控制臺登錄”,進入登錄頁面。
3. 根據提示輸入管理員賬號和密碼進行登錄。
4. 進入服務器命令行界面后,輸入以下命令安裝CentOS 7.x:
“`
yum update
yum install epel-release
yum install wget
wget http://mirrors.aliyun.com/repo/Centos-7.repo -O /etc/yum.repos.d/CentOS-Base.repo
yum clean all
yum makecache
yum install net-tools rsync sysstat irqbalance vim lrzsz unzip
“`
安裝完成之后,我們可以執行以下命令來檢查是否安裝成功:
“`
rpm -q centos-release
“`
如果成功安裝,會輸出類似“centos-release-7-9.2009.1.el7.centos.x86_64”的內容。
三、配置服務器環境
在安裝操作系統之后,我們需要對服務器進行一些環境配置,包括安裝必要的軟件、配置防火墻和設置時區等。
1. 配置防火墻
安裝防火墻軟件并且開放http和https兩個端口。我們執行以下命令安裝防火墻軟件:
“`
yum install firewalld firewall-config -y
“`
安裝完成之后,輸入以下命令:
“`
systemctl start firewalld
systemctl enable firewalld
“`
然后,我們需要開放http和https兩個端口。輸入以下命令:
“`
firewall-cmd –add-port=80/tcp –permanent
firewall-cmd –add-port=443/tcp –permanent
firewall-cmd –add-port=8080/tcp –permanent
firewall-cmd –add-service=http –permanent
firewall-cmd –add-service=https –permanent
firewall-cmd –reload
“`
2. 安裝必要的軟件
我們需要安裝一些必要的軟件,包括Nginx、PHP、MySQL等。
(1)安裝Nginx
輸入以下命令安裝Nginx:
“`
yum install nginx -y
“`
(2)安裝MySQL
輸入以下命令安裝MySQL:
“`
yum install mariadb mariadb-server -y
systemctl start mariadb
systemctl enable mariadb
mysql_secure_installation
“`
當我們執行 mysql_secure_installation 命令時,會提示我們設置 MySQL root 用戶的密碼、刪除匿名賬戶、禁止root遠程登錄等操作,按照提示操作即可。
(3)安裝PHP
輸入以下命令安裝PHP:
“`
yum install php php-fpm php-cli php-mysql php-common php-devel php-pear php-gd php-mbstring php-mcrypt php-tidy php-xml php-pdo php-json -y
“`
輸入以下命令開啟php-fpm服務:
“`
systemctl start php-fpm
systemctl enable php-fpm
“`
3. 設置時區
我們需要根據時區對服務器進行一些設置。首先,需要查看時區列表:
“`
timedatectl list-timezones
“`
然后,選擇適合自己的時區,例如Asia/Shanghai,輸入以下命令進行設置:
“`
timedatectl set-timezone Asia/Shanghai
“`
四、上傳網站文件
在完成以上配置之后,我們需要將自己的網站文件上傳到服務器上,放置在合適的目錄下,例如“/var/www/html”。
我們可以使用工具,例如WinSCP來上傳網站文件。連接服務器之后,將文件上傳到指定目錄下即可。
五、綁定域名
在上傳網站文件之后,我們需要將自己的域名綁定到服務器上,才能通過域名來訪問網站。在這里,我們以阿里云為例,介紹如何將自己的域名解析到百度云服務器IP地址上。
1. 登錄阿里云控制臺,進入域名管理頁面。
2. 找到需要綁定的域名,點擊“解析”按鈕,進入解析頁面。
3. 在解析頁面中,點擊“添加記錄”按鈕,添加一條A記錄。
4. 將“記錄類型”設置為“A”、“記錄值”設置為百度云服務器的IP地址、“主機記錄”設置為“@”。
5. 保存并等待一段時間,解析生效即可。
六、啟動網站服務
在完成以上配置之后,我們可以啟動網站服務。首先,我們需要編輯Nginx的配置文件,輸入以下命令進行編輯:
“`
vim /etc/nginx/nginx.conf
“`
我們可以將以下內容添加到http服務段中的server段中:
“`
server {
listen 80;
server_name example.com;
root /var/www/html;
index index.php index.html index.htm;
location / {
try_files $uri $uri/ /index.php$is_args$args;
}
location ~ \\.php$ {
fastcgi_pass unix:/run/php-fpm/php-fpm.sock;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
}
“`
在這里,我們將監聽端口設置為80端口,將example.com替換成自己的域名,將根目錄設置為“/var/www/html”,并且啟用了PHP解析。
編輯完成之后,輸入以下命令重新加載Nginx配置文件:
“`
nginx -s reload
“`
然后,我們可以啟動PHP服務:
“`
systemctl start php-fpm
systemctl enable php-fpm
“`
最后,我們可以在瀏覽器中輸入自己的域名,訪問自己的網站了。
總結
百度云服務器作為一款非常實用的云計算產品,可以支持我們搭建自己的網站服務。在本文中,我們介紹了如何購買百度云服務器、安裝CentOS操作系統、配置服務器環境、上傳網站文件、綁定域名以及啟動網站服務等步驟。希望本文能夠幫助到有需要的讀者朋友。
以上就是小編關于“百度云服務器架設網站”的分享和介紹
三五互聯(35.com)是經工信部、ICANN、CNNIC認證的全球頂級域名注冊服務機構,是中國五星級域名注冊商!有超過2000萬個域名通過三五互聯注冊并管理,超過100萬個網站托管在三五互聯云服務器和虛擬主機。三五互聯支持數十個頂級域名的注冊與管理,支持批量查詢、批量注冊、批量解析、智能解析、批量過戶等便捷好用的功能,擁有非常好的使用體驗。
目前,三五互聯域名注冊正在特價,最低僅需1元!
更多詳情請見:http://www.shinetop.cn/services/domain/
三五互聯域名搶注預定,支持搶注各類高價值老域名,支持“建站歷史、百度收錄、百度權重、歷史外鏈、百度評價、搜狗反鏈”等綜合檢索功能,共計26項!可快速精準定位到您想要定位到的各類精品域名!同時,三五互聯域名搶注集成了全球多個搶注商(近200個搶注商,還將陸續增加),整理出13條搶注通道,從根本上提升了搶注成功率!
其中,1號通道,實測搶注成功率高達99% 。每天三五互聯預釋放功能還會釋放若干優質過期域名,可以直接搶注競拍。
趕緊預訂搶注心儀的優質域名吧:http://www.shinetop.cn/booking/